Intan Azura Mokhtar is a scholar working on Education, Library and Information Sciences and Developmental and Educational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Intan Azura Mokhtar has authored 32 papers receiving a total of 608 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Education, 10 papers in Library and Information Sciences and 7 papers in Developmental and Educational Psychology. Recurrent topics in Intan Azura Mokhtar’s work include Library Science and Information Literacy (10 papers), Educational Strategies and Epistemologies (5 papers) and Educational Methods and Media Use (4 papers). Intan Azura Mokhtar is often cited by papers focused on Library Science and Information Literacy (10 papers), Educational Strategies and Epistemologies (5 papers) and Educational Methods and Media Use (4 papers). Intan Azura Mokhtar collaborates with scholars based in Singapore, United Arab Emirates and China. Intan Azura Mokhtar's co-authors include Shaheen Majid, Schubert Foo, Brendan Luyt, Yin Leng Theng, Xue Zhang, Arif Perdana, Yun‐Ke Chang, Yin‐Leng Theng, Ravi Sharma and Xue Zhang and has published in prestigious journals such as Technology in Society, The Knee and Library & Information Science Research.
